Job Summary:
Zipcolimited is a digital financial services company offering innovative products. They are seeking a Product Analyst to provide insights and clarity to their product organization, focusing on improving customer experience through analysis and reporting of product funnels.
Responsibilities:
β’ Scrutinize user behavior across product funnels to generate insights that improve outcomes for both customers and the business.
β’ Partner with product managers on Zipβs top product initiatives to track outcomes against our hypotheses.
β’ Proactively socialize funnel insights with cross-functional partners in product, design, and engineering.
β’ Lead weekly reporting of key funnel metrics and product analytics updates, including discrepancy tracking.
β’ Own and evolve our product analytics catalog to ensure structured, decision-ready data.
β’ Collaborate with the broader analytics team, sharing insights and proactively flagging upcoming work to Zipβs data organization.
β’ Maintain and continuously update an A/B testing catalog with actionable experiment learnings.
β’ Build and maintain a centralized repository of competitor funnel screenshots and research.
Qualifications:
Required:
β’ Bachelorβs degree in a relevant field (e.g., Business, Economics, Computer Science, Data Analytics) required.
β’ 3+ years of experience in product analytics, product operations, or growth roles, preferably in a tech or fintech environment.
β’ Professional experience working in analytics at a fintech or e-commerce company, including on-the-job examples of how youβve identified funnel opportunities to drive meaningful customer and business outcomes.
β’ Proven ability to turn complex data into clear insights that drive decision-making.
β’ Strong SQL skills to write data queries.
β’ Proficiency in at least one analytics visualization tool (e.g., Looker, Tableau, Amplitude).
β’ Familiarity with experimentation frameworks and experience interpreting A/B test results.
β’ Strong cross-functional communication skills experience presenting data to influence stakeholders.
β’ Highly organized with a systems mindset β able to maintain catalogs and documentation that scale.
β’ Curious, collaborative, and comfortable working with multiple stakeholders.
β’ Demonstrated use of AI in the performance of your role.
Preferred:
β’ Advanced degree or formal training in data analytics or product strategy is a plus.
β’ Bonus: Experience conducting competitive research or user journey mapping.
Company:
Zip Co Limited (ASX: ZIP) is a digital financial services company, offering innovative, people-centred products that bring customers and merchants together. Founded in 2013, the company is headquartered in Sydney, New South Wales, AUS, with a team of 1001-5000 employees. The company is currently Public Company. Zip Co has a track record of offering H1B sponsorships.
